Shimoga Subbanna or Shivamogga Subbanna (born as G. Subramanya, 14 December 1938 – 11 August 2022) was an Indian Sugama Sangeetha(Light Music) playback singer in the Kannada language. He received a national award for singing for the song Kaadu Kudure Odi Banditta in the film Kaadu Kudure.{{Cite web|url=http://www.hindu.com/2009/01/06/stories/2009010660810300.htm |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20100728183449/http://www.hindu.com/2009/01/06/stories/2009010660810300.htm |url-status=dead |archive-date=28 July 2010 |title=Karnataka / Bangalore News: 'A synonym for melody and affability' |date=6 January 2009 |work=The Hindu |access-date=10 March 2012}} He was the first Kannadiga to win National Award for playback singing.{{Cite web|url=http://www.hindu.com/fr/2009/01/02/stories/2009010251210100.htm |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20121107084511/http://www.hindu.com/fr/2009/01/02/stories/2009010251210100.htm |url-status=dead |archive-date=7 November 2012 |title=Friday Review Bangalore / Events: Songbird's story |date=2 January 2009 |work=The Hindu |access-date=10 March 2012}} Apart from being an exemplary singer and musician, he was also an advocate and a notary public.

Death

He died on 11 August 2022, at the age of 83, after suffering from a cardiac arrest.{{Cite news |url=https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/city/bengaluru/renowned-kannada-playback-singer-shivamogga-subbanna-passes-away/articleshow/93508148.cms |title=Renowned Kannada playback singer Shivamogga Subbanna passes away |work=Times of India |date=11 August 2022 |access-date=11 August 2022}}
